The company ran its last log drive on the West Branch of the Penobscot in 1971, shortly after the state legislature mandated an end to the practice within five years, citing environmental impacts from logjams and debris. The Golden Road is a 96mile (154km) private road built by the Great Northern Paper Company that stretches from the St. Zacharie Border Crossing to its former mill at Millinocket, Maine. The traffic included some massive rigs: Bouchards father, the late company founder Harold Bouchard, designed a massive triple trailer for the Golden Road known simply as the Big One. Because of the roads crown, Bouchard says, truck drivers liked to stay toward the center, to minimize the risk of tipping over. The road's name is often believed to have been because of its cost (Great Northern said in the 1980s the cost of maintaining its road network was $6.8 million/year) but company officials said the road was actually considered a big cost savingsnoting the shipping timber down the river took about 18 months and there would be loss of logs in the process and the road shortened the process to a few days.
